Why you'll love this job

  • This job is a member of the Loyalty Fraud Team within Corporate Security.
  • Responsible for investigating compromise of customers’ accounts, and any fraud/abuse related to the loyalty program and its ancillary products.

What you'll do

  • Analyze account takeovers/ account redemption fraud.
  • Manage Sale Barter and Elite Benefits dilution.
  • Determines, negotiates and administers settlement agreements.
  • Represent AA in litigation matters related to Loyalty.
  • Investigate and oversee employee fraud cases. 
  • Works with various business units to close security gaps in policies and systems
  • Collaborates with Legal and HR, and business partners as a subject matter expert,
  • Effectively communicates necessary amendments to the AAdvantage Terms and Conditions.
  • Works with various IT business units in identifying and building more proficient fraud tools for the department.
  • Investigates fraud allegations; prepares cases and follow-up with employee interviews on internal cases; sends findings to HR and local management for employment decisions.
  • Assists legal with investigations on pre-litigation matters.
  • Facilitate town halls for front line team member engagement and awareness.
  • Partner with IT Security on Threat Actor detection and mitigation.
